From threesomes, to cuddle puddles, to full-on orgies, group play exists on a spectrum of connection and desire. And the question that almost always comes up is: “But how do you stay safe?” In this episode, we explore STI protocols not as fear-based prevention, but as rituals of care that make intimacy deeper, hotter, and freer. We talk about testing rhythms, window periods, and sharing results as practices that build trust and expand pleasure.

What’s Inside:
-What group play looks like across the spectrum
-How queer and trans communities have shaped group and play spaces as sites of affirmation and liberation
-STI protocols as frameworks of clarity and care
-What to know about comprehensive testing and window periods
-Sexy, simple questions to ask partners about sexual health and safety
